COP CORNER - Aug 2016 Published Sept. 13, 2016 By Katherine Hammer 21st Security Forces Squadron PETERSON AIR FORCE BASE, Colo. -- During August, the 21st Security Forces Squadron, along with facility parking wardens issued 45 traffic citations. Excessive speed and expired registration comprised the majority of the citations. Suspendable offenses consisted excessive speed, driving on a suspended license, and operating an unregistered vehicle. Additionally, there were two off-base and one on-base alcohol-related driving incidents which will result in a suspension or revocation of driving privileges.Security Forces responded to more than 110 calls for service during August.
